Today, the MCP family remembers and celebrates the life of Ray Buyle, a former colleague, respected leader, teacher, mentor, and lifelong builder who recently passed away following his courageous battle with ALS.

Ray joined McPherson Contractors, now MCP Group, in 1993 and spent 14 years with our company. During that time, he left his mark on countless people and projects, but perhaps none more recognizable than the Robert J. Dole Institute of Politics in Lawrence, Kansas, where Ray served as Project Manager.

For a proud K-State alumnus, we have to imagine spending that much time building a landmark on the KU campus required a special kind of professional dedication. We like to think Ray made sure it was built exceptionally well because, Wildcat or not, he simply didn’t know how to do things any other way.

But the structures Ray helped build tell only part of his story.

After more than two decades in the construction industry, Ray took his knowledge and experience into the classroom at Kansas State University, where he spent 17 years helping prepare the next generation of construction and engineering professionals. He ultimately became professor and head of the GE Johnson Department of Architectural Engineering and Construction Science in K State’s Carl R. Ice College of Engineering.

In other words, Ray went from building remarkable projects to building remarkable people.

Those of us in construction know that our best work is meant to outlast us. Buildings stand. Lessons get passed down. Relationships continue. And the people we mentor go on to build things we may never get to see.

Ray’s legacy does all of those things.

We are grateful that MCP was part of his story, and even more grateful that Ray was part of ours.

Our thoughts are with Ray’s family, friends, former colleagues, students and the entire K-State community as they remember a man whose influence on the Kansas construction industry will be felt for generations.

Work is underway on Torgeson Electric’s newest Manhattan office.

Crews took advantage of a break in the weather last week to complete the slab-on-grade for the new 11,000+ sq. ft. facility.

With the slab complete, work is moving into the next phase. Upcoming site activities include sanitary and storm sewer installation, water service, site grading and underground electrical rough-in.

Our Facility Services team recently completed the renovation of the 10th floor at the Landon State Office Building in downtown Topeka. The 10,000 square-foot office remodel transformed the space with new drywall, lighting, HVAC systems, paint, casework, acoustical ceiling tile, doors, hardware, and glazing.
 
From demolition to the finishing touches, our crew delivered a modern, functional workspace that will better serve the building’s occupants. Great work to everyone involved in bringing this project to the finish line!

The Reserves at Grand View Heights is officially complete!

Located in Laramie, Wyoming, this new multi-family community adds 42 residential units across two 3-story walk-up buildings, along with covered parking and a resident clubhouse.

From the retaining wall stonework that shapes the site to the modern finishes throughout each unit, this project required attention to detail at every stage of construction.

Building in Wyoming comes with its own unique challenges, from weather and site conditions to the logistics that come with working in a growing mountain community.

Thanks to the hard work of our project teams and trade partners, we successfully delivered a new community that residents will be proud to call home.
